NBK Automobile­s signs deal to supply HBK Contractin­g with Mercedes-Benz Actros heads

-

Nasser Bin Khaled Automobile­s, the authorised general distributo­r of Mercedes-Benz in Qatar, signed a deal to supply HBK Contractin­g Company with MercedesBe­nz Actros heads. The agreement aims to upgrade the HBK Contractin­g Company’s fleet of trucks and meet the increasing demands of its projects.

Boasting decades of experience, the Actros has become the most frequently sold truck in the region. High reliabilit­y and low total cost of ownership coupled with impressive durability – these are the characteri­stics that traditiona­lly define Mercedes-Benz trucks.

It is what they are known for and the reason they are so highly-regarded and coveted across the globe. The Actros impresses with their highly sophistica­ted powertrain, comfortabl­e cabs and a vast range of models tailored to individual markets.

Thanks to a broad product offering, it meets the needs of long-distance haulage, as well as heavy-duty short-radius transport and distributi­on haulage. Highly efficient, reliable, and durable, this truck boasts many benefits.

HBK Contractin­g was founded in 1970 and is one of the major constructi­on companies in Qatar. HBK contractin­g executes many giant projects in Qatar, contributi­ng in the national economy progress. The company has executed giant projects for the public and private sectors, maintainin­g its position at the top of the constructi­on companies at all times.

Establishe­d in 1957, Nasser Bin Khaled Automobile­s is Qatar’s exclusive distributo­r of three of the world’s most respected, iconic brands: Mercedes-Benz, Mercedes-AMG and Mercedes-Maybach.
